Verizon Unveils Digital Coupon Service

Telecom provider Verizon is offering a free digital supermarket coupon service for its wireless and FiOS TV customers. Customers can obtain Verizon SpendSmart digital coupons via wireless phone, TV or computer. Verizon is providing this service through a partnership with online mobile coupon network Cellfire. Meebo Unifies SocNets, Content Sites on Engagement Platform

IM service aggregation site Meebo has launched "multi-network IM access," which enables users to unify other social graphs on its platform, including major social networks and gaming sites. A sharing interface also enables them to swap content with greater ease. "Content sites interested in increasing the volume of content sharing, but without their own social graph, can use the multi-network IM feature to expand their reach and drive social interactions," the company said. Ecast Mashes Up Social Media to Night Life

LocaModa, a firm that connects digital out-of-home advertising with mobile and web networks, inked a partnership with Ecast to bring social media to bars and night clubs. Ecast provides advertising, digital music and entertainment across 10,000 bars and nightclubs nationwide. The company agreed to license LocaModa's platform and associated applications on Ecast EQ, the entertainment solution it uses to broadcast digital media at local hotspots. SIDEBAR Uses Mobile 'White Space' to Serve Viral Advergames

digital SIDEBAR is launching a mobile ad platform that delivers interactive ads through the white space in mobile phones. The service will be piloted before going public. "White space" represents the space not used to make a call: the screen that appears when a user is dialing, the hang-up screen, or the time between sending and receiving a text message.
